Srinagar: Shri Amarnath Shrine Board (SASB) has increased online registration quota for pilgrims willing to undergo the religious voyage to the cave shrine after getting huge public response of its registration via the Internet initiative. Over 3.5 lakh people have registered since May 7 for the annual Amarnath Yatra this year through various online facilities, banks and post offices, Shri Amarnathji Shrine Board CEO Navin K Choudhary said.
At a review meeting yesterday, SASB - which is chaired by Jammu and Kashmir Governor N N Vohra, decided to release an additional quota for online registration through JK Bank website. "The move was taken after it was observed that online registration has been most favoured and found convenient by the pilgrims," an official spokesman said.
The annual pilgrimage to Amarnath shrine cave is scheduled to commence from June 25.
